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Cinnamon Dog-faced Bat | Impunctate Cellophane Bee |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ordates) | Arthropoda (Arthropods)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Insecta (Insects) |
| Order | Chiroptera (Bats) | Hymenoptera (Ants, Bees & Wasps) |
| Family | Molossidae | Colletidae |
| Genus | Cynomops | Colletes |
| Species | Cynomops abrasus | Colletes impunctatus |
